Macbook Pro 2017 shows black screen with a pointer on shutting down.

Hi there, my Macbook Pro 2017 is not shutting down, instead it shows a black screen with a pointer. I tried to remain patient and wait for nearly hour but no luck. I then forcefully shut it down. But every time I try to shutdown it keeps showing the black screen.

Your cooperation and help would be much appreciated. Thanks!

MacBook Pro (13-inch, 2017, 2 TBT3), macOS High Sierra (10.13.2)

Shut down

Reset the System Management Controller (SMC)

https://support.apple.com/en-us/HT201295

repeat 2/3 times


Reset the nonvolatile random-access memory (NVRAM)

(OPTION+COMMAND+p+r at Startup)

How to reset NVRAM on your Mac - Apple Support

repeat 2/3 times


Then use safeboot (SHIFT at Startup)

https://support.apple.com/en-us/HT201262


Then reboot normally with devices disconnected and shut down.

if the problem persists you may post an etrecheck report for further analysis.
